Mother francis raphael dominican writer, born bromley, near london, england, 1823; died stone, staffordshire, england, 1894. Originally a member of the church of england, she was influenced by the tractarian movement and became a catholic in 1850.

Only three days before her death, which happened on april 29, 1894, mother francis raphael wrote the following words in a confidential letter to a friend:— write, read, and study—do what you will, there is only one real thing to do in this world, and that is, to love; all else must be centred in this, and flow from it, or it will be like a tinkling cymbal.

Memoir, history or record composed from personal observation and experience. Closely related to, and often confused with, autobiography, a memoir usually differs chiefly in there being a greater degree of emphasis placed on external events in memoirs, whereas autobiographies are concerned primarily with the writer.
